Before beginning an experiment, it's essential to review the experimental protocol to understand the objectives and procedures. Ensure that all necessary materials and equipment are prepared and in good working condition. Additionally, conduct a risk assessment to identify and mitigate any potential hazards associated with the experiment.
In general none. However, argon is often used to clear out tanks which are filled with explosive or combustible gases. Argon, being a dense gas will collect at the bottom of such a tank and poses a risk of death by asphyxiation.

To ensure that hazards are not released into a confined space, it’s essential to conduct thorough risk assessments and implement engineering controls, such as ventilation systems that maintain air quality. Regular monitoring of air quality and potential contaminants should be performed. Additionally, using lockout/tagout procedures to control energy sources and providing proper training for workers on safety protocols are crucial tactics to minimize risks. Lastly, establishing emergency response plans can help address any unexpected releases quickly.

If by risk management you mean the analysis of the risk involved with doing something i.e. using power tools. Then the starting part is identify the risk, then identify the possible hazards, then come up with ways to prevent these hazards. Example: Radial saw, cuts/dismemberment, proper training and awareness of blade at all times. Hope this helps. Cheers, Bruce.
